Driving Forces: What's Propelling the Strontium Oxalate Market?

Several key factors are propelling the growth of the strontium oxalate market. The increasing demand from the chemical industry for strontium oxalate as a precursor in the synthesis of other strontium compounds is a major driver. The compound's unique properties, such as its high purity and controlled reactivity, make it an attractive starting material for various chemical processes. Furthermore, the burgeoning industrial applications of strontium-based materials, particularly in pyrotechnics and electronics, are fueling the demand for strontium oxalate. The rising adoption of high-precision technologies in diverse sectors like aerospace and telecommunications further contributes to this growth. The development of more efficient and cost-effective manufacturing processes for strontium oxalate is also boosting its market appeal. Technological advancements in production methods have lowered the cost of strontium oxalate, making it more accessible to a wider range of industries. Lastly, the increasing awareness regarding the environmental impact of manufacturing processes and the relatively low environmental impact associated with strontium oxalate production are contributing to its growing acceptance and adoption across various applications. This factor is particularly relevant in environmentally conscious industries seeking sustainable alternatives.

Challenges and Restraints in Strontium Oxalate Market

Despite the promising growth outlook, the strontium oxalate market faces several challenges. Fluctuations in the price of raw materials, especially strontium-containing minerals, can significantly impact the cost of production and consequently affect market prices. The availability and consistent supply of high-quality raw materials are crucial for maintaining the production of high-purity strontium oxalate. Furthermore, stringent environmental regulations surrounding the production and handling of chemical compounds can impose compliance costs on manufacturers, increasing the overall cost of production. The competitive landscape is relatively fragmented, with numerous players vying for market share. This competition can lead to price pressures and make it challenging for companies to maintain profitability. Technological advancements are also an ongoing challenge, as manufacturers constantly need to adapt and innovate to maintain their competitiveness. The potential emergence of substitute materials or alternative production methods could also pose a threat to the market's growth. Finally, variations in regional demand patterns due to factors such as economic conditions and industrial development can create uncertainties and affect market stability.

Key Region or Country & Segment to Dominate the Market

The strontium oxalate market exhibits diverse regional growth patterns. While precise figures are proprietary to this report, certain trends are evident:

  • North America and Europe: These regions are expected to maintain a significant share of the market due to well-established chemical industries, substantial R&D investments, and a high demand for high-purity materials. The strong presence of established chemical manufacturers and a robust regulatory framework supporting technological advancements contribute to their market dominance in terms of both consumption and production.

  • Asia Pacific: This region is poised for significant growth, driven by rapid industrialization, increasing investments in infrastructure projects, and the expanding electronics and pyrotechnics sectors. Countries like China and India are key players in the region's growth story, offering opportunities for strontium oxalate producers.

  • 99.999% Purity Segment: The segment focused on ultra-high purity strontium oxalate is expected to witness strong growth, driven by the growing demand from specialized industries requiring materials with minimal impurities. This segment caters to high-precision applications where the presence of even trace impurities can significantly affect performance. The higher purity grade commands a premium price, contributing to greater revenue generation within this segment.

  • Industrial Applications Segment: This segment dominates the market due to the extensive use of strontium oxalate in various industrial processes, including pyrotechnics, ceramics, and metallurgy. The large-scale consumption in these sectors drives high volumes and significant revenue generation within this segment.

In summary, while North America and Europe hold significant current market share, the Asia-Pacific region is experiencing dynamic growth, fueled by industrial expansion and increased demand across multiple sectors. The ultra-high purity strontium oxalate (99.999%) segment presents substantial opportunities due to its importance in specialized applications. The industrial application segment, however, remains the largest due to sheer volume consumption.
